flag France won’t join military ops in Strait of Hormuz while fighting continues, Macron says.

French President Emmanuel Macron stated on March 17, 2026, that France will not join any military operations to secure the Strait of Hormuz while active hostilities continue, emphasizing France’s neutrality in the ongoing conflict. His remarks, made during a cabinet meeting, contradict U.S. President Donald Trump’s claim that France would cooperate, with Macron stressing that any future maritime escort mission would require a ceasefire and international coordination. France remains open to participating in a post-conflict coalition to ensure safe passage through the strait but will not take part in military efforts during active combat. The statement reflects broader European reluctance to engage in the conflict, as regional tensions escalate and global oil prices surge.
